Buying Guide
Key factors to consider when choosing a pressure pump for a garden hose include flow rate, pressure, prime height, power source, and intended use. Below are considerations from multiple perspectives to help you balance performance, noise, and durability.
- Flow rate vs. pressure: Higher GPM (flow) typically pairs with lower PSI for portable garden tasks. For expansive irrigation or spray tasks requiring high pressure, select pumps with 60–70 PSI or higher. If you mainly need quick water transfer, a higher GPH may be more valuable than peak pressure.
- Self-priming and elevation: Self-priming capability matters when the pump is mounted above the water source or when the source is at a different height. Consider vertical lift requirements based on your yard layout and tank placement.
- Automation and control: Pumps with built-in pressure switches automatically adjust output and shut off, conserving energy and reducing wear. This is beneficial for continuous irrigation or multi-outlet setups.
- Noise and heat management: Diaphragm pumps with robust bearings and thermal protection help maintain quieter operation and protect motor life during extended use. Look for models with automatic thermal cutoffs or overload protection.
- Power source and portability: AC-powered units are common for fixed installations, while compact units with power cords or plug-and-play configurations emphasize portability for seasonal tasks.
- Materials and durability: Diaphragm pumps and brass connectors tend to last longer in outdoor environments. Check for corrosion-resistant components and sealed housings if the pump may encounter rain or splashes.
- Maintenance and service: Choose models with accessible parts and good after-sales support. Read user reviews about reliability and ease of repair for long-term use.
- Compatibility with hoses and fittings: Confirm the discharge and intake ports (inches) match your garden hose fittings. Some units include connectors or strainers to simplify setup.
- Intended use scenarios: For delicate irrigation, look for adjustable pressure ranges and gentle spray options. For cleaning or high-volume watering, prioritize higher PSI and larger GPM.
